Your Impact

The Assistant Marketing Manager, Loyalty, will work with Loyalty Marketing leadership to assist in planning, implementing, and operating loyalty initiatives to engage and retain customers by leveraging customer insights, understanding the competitive landscape, and working with cross-functional teams. The position will report to Marketing Manager, Loyalty, and will serve as a subject matter expert for Loyalty and Customer Marketing. The Assistant Marketing Manager will represent the work of the team to key internal and external stakeholders, as well as lead execution of loyalty campaigns. Demonstrated experience developing and managing loyalty programs in collaboration with Marketing, Data Analytics, Finance, and/or Technology teams is a plus

What You Will Do

  • Support execution of overall loyalty strategy, ensuring that projects track against program plan and forecasts
  • Partner with Loyalty Marketing Managers to develop organizational processes for new loyalty functionalities and features
  • Participate in business requirement gathering for program development and features implementation
  • Partner with Loyalty Marketing, Brand Marketing, Customer Insights, Technology, and DACI teams in analyzing/interpreting data to draw clear, actionable insights and tactical plans for the assigned customer segment to drive customer engagement and retention
  • Support Loyalty Marketing Managers in developing and tracking OKRs (objectives and key results), identifying trends and continuous improvement opportunities
  • Apply understanding of modern marketing solutions (e.g., first- and zero-party data-enabled personalization, loyalty programs) to campaign planning
  • Be an advocate for the customer and bring customer-first mindset to all initiatives
  • Be comfortable operating in constant, rapid test & learn environment and driving organizational change through action
  • Establish strong working relationships with cross-functional peers

Minimum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ree Marketing, Digital, E-Commerce etc. or equivalent years of experience in lieu of education requirement, if applicable
  • 3 Years Data-driven marketing experience
  • 1 Year Strong business acumen and experience running a P&L and/or working alongside P&L owners
  • 1 Year Experience writing strategic briefs and working cross-functionally and leading customer marketing or integrated teams
  • 1 Year Leadership experience, preferably in Agile cross-functional teams

Preferred Skills/Education

  • 1 Year Experience managing loyalty programs at a retailer

About Lowe's

Lowe's Companies, Inc. (NYSE: LOW) is a FORTUNE® 100 home improvement company serving approximately 16 million customer transactions a week, with total fiscal year 2024 sales of more than $83 billion. Lowe's employs approximately 300,000 associates and operates over 1,700 home improvement stores, 530 branches and 130 distribution centers. Based in Mooresville, N.C., Lowe's supports the communities it serves through programs focused on creating safe, affordable housing, improving community spaces, helping to develop the next generation of skilled trade experts and providing disaster relief to communities in need.
